Mire használható az összevonás függvény az Oracle-ben?
Mire használható az összevonás függvény az Oracle-ben?

Videó: Mire használható az összevonás függvény az Oracle-ben?

Videó: Mire használható az összevonás függvény az Oracle-ben?
Videó: 1. Microsoft Access - Adatbáziskezelési alapok 2024, December
Anonim

Meghatározás: A Oracle COALESCE funkció a lista első nem NULL kifejezését adja vissza. Ha a lista összes kifejezésének értéke NULL, akkor a COALESCE funkció NULL-t ad vissza. Az Oracle COALESCE funkció teszi használat a "zárlati kiértékelés".

Egyszerűen így, miért használjuk az összevonás funkciót az Oracle-ben?

Az Oracle COALESCE () funkció elfogadja az argumentumok listáját, és visszaadja az elsőt, amelyik kiértékeli, nem nulla értékre. Ebben szintaxis , az EGYESÜL () funkció a lista első nem nulla kifejezését adja vissza. Ehhez legalább két kifejezés szükséges. Abban az esetben, ha az összes kifejezés értéke null, a funkció nullát ad vissza.

Ezenkívül mi az az összevonás az Oracle SQL-ben? Leírás. Az Jóslat /PLSQL EGYESÜL függvény a lista első nem nulla kifejezését adja vissza. Ha minden kifejezés értéke null, akkor a EGYESÜL függvény nullát ad vissza.

Hasonlóképpen, mi a célja az összevonásnak az SQL-ben?

Az SQL Coalesce és IsNull függvények a NULL értékek kezelésére szolgálnak. A kifejezés kiértékelési folyamata során a NULL értékeket a felhasználó által megadott értékre cseréljük. Az SQL Coalesce függvény sorrendben kiértékeli az argumentumokat, és mindig az első nem null értéket adja vissza a definiált argumentumlistából.

Mi a különbség az NVL és az egyesülés között?

NVL és COALESCE ugyanazt a funkciót használják az alapértelmezett érték megadására abban az esetben, ha az oszlop NULL-t ad vissza. Az különbségek vannak: NVL csak 2 érvet fogad el, míg EGYESÜL több érvet is felvehet. NVL értékeli mind az érveket, mind EGYESÜL leáll egy nem Null érték első előfordulásakor.

Ajánlott: